如何创建自己的加密货币:全面指南

                        在数字化时代,加密货币作为一种新型的资产类别,已经引起了广泛的关注。越来越多的人希望创建自己的加密货币,以满足特定的商业需求或实现个人的投资目标。这篇文章将深入探讨创建加密货币的过程、技术基础、可能面临的挑战以及成功实施的关键因素。

                        1. 加密货币的基本概念

                        加密货币是一种使用密码学技术进行安全交易的数字货币,它基于区块链技术。区块链是一种去中心化的分布式账本技术,它能够确保所有交易的透明性、安全性和不可篡改性。加密货币的去中心化特性使得其不依赖于中央银行或金融机构,用户可以在全球范围内自由交易。

                        创建自己的加密货币首先需要明确其用途和目标。是作为支付手段、用于开发特定应用程序、还是作为投资工具?这个决定将直接影响你选择的技术堆栈和实施过程。

                        2. 创建加密货币的步骤

                        创建加密货币的过程通常可以分为以下几个步骤:

                        2.1 确定加密货币的目标及用途

                        在动手之前,首先要明确你想要创建的加密货币的目的。如果是为了支持某项创新技术、设计用于特定的市场需求,或者希望其成为支付的工具,明确的目标有助于后续步骤的设计。

                        2.2 选择区块链平台

                        创建加密货币的一个关键决策是选择合适的区块链平台。常用的平台包括以太坊、波场、Binance Smart Chain等。以太坊是最流行的平台之一,支持创建智能合约和去中心化应用。

                        2.3 设计代币经济模型

                        接下来,需要设计你的加密货币的经济模型,包括总供应量、发行方式、通货膨胀比率、奖励机制等。这些因素将影响代币的分配和市场行为。

                        2.4 编写智能合约

                        在选择好平台之后,便可以着手编写智能合约,负责定义代币的交易规则和自动执行的合约条件。智能合约的语言通常是 Solidity(以太坊),编写时需要遵循平台的规范和标准。

                        2.5 部署加密货币

                        完成智能合约后,可以通过相应的工具将其部署到区块链上。以以太坊为例,可以使用 Remix、Truffle等工具进行智能合约的测试与部署。务必确保在主网上线之前进行充分的测试,以避免任何潜在的漏洞和意外情况。

                        3. 加密货币的挖矿过程

                        一旦部署了你的加密货币,接下来的步骤是挖矿。挖矿是验证交易并将其添加到区块链的过程,这一过程涉及计算复杂的数学题。为了让用户参与其中,可以设立挖矿奖励和交易手续费。

                        挖矿的方式分为两种:一种是工作量证明(PoW),一种是权益证明(PoS)。在PoW中,矿工通过解决复杂的问题获得奖励;而在PoS中,用户根据他们持有的币量获得验证的机会。选择合适的挖矿机制至关重要,因为这关系到网络的安全性和去中心化程度。

                        4. 加密货币的推广与社区建设

                        加密货币成功的另一个关键因素是有效的市场推广和社区建设。通过各种渠道宣传你的加密货币,包括社交媒体、在线论坛、区块链大会等,可以增加项目的知名度。

                        一个活跃的社区不仅能够提供支持和反馈,还能吸引更多的开发者和投资者。确保与社区保持良好的沟通,并定期更新项目的进展,以赢得信任并促使更多的人参与。

                        5. 可能面临的挑战

                        虽然创建加密货币的过程看似简单,但实际上会面临诸多挑战,包括技术难题、市场竞争、法律合规等。了解这些挑战的性质和应对策略,对于项目的成功至关重要。

                        例如,法律合规性是一个确保你创建的加密货币不会受到法律限制的重要方面。不同国家对加密货币的监管政策不尽相同,确保遵循适用法律是非常重要的。

                        6. 相关问题探讨

                        问题 1:创建加密货币需要什么技术基础?

                        创建加密货币的技术基础包括了解区块链技术、智能合约编写、网络安全知识等。区块链的架构、工作机制以及分布式数据库的运作原理是必备的知识。此外,学习编程语言(如Solidity、Javascript等)可以帮助你实现具体的功能。

                        问题 2:如何确保加密货币的安全性?

                        加密货币的安全性可以通过多种手段确保,包括使用经过审计的智能合约、部署多重签名功能、进行频繁的系统监控等。安全性是用户选择加密货币的重要因素,确保代码的无漏洞也是保证安全的重要手段之一。

                        问题 3:如何选择合适的区块链平台?

                        选择区块链平台应考虑项目的需求、预期的用户群体、技术的灵活性和社区氛围。以太坊适合需要智能合约的项目,而Binance Smart Chain则能提供更低的费用和更快的交易速度。你需要比较不同平台的优缺点,做出明智的选择。

                        问题 4:如何进行市场推广和社区建设?

                        市场推广和社区建设可以通过社交媒体营销(如Twitter、Discord)、参与技术会议、开发者大会和线上活动等多种方式实现。互动和透明的沟通是吸引和维持用户的重要方式,定期发布项目进展和运营数据,有助于保持用户的信任和忠诚度。

                        问题 5:创建加密货币的法律合规问题有哪些?

                        法律合规问题主要涉及知识产权、投资合规以及交易监管等方面。在创建之前,需了解你所在国家和地区的法律条款,确保项目的合规性,避免因法律问题导致的交易障碍和信用危机。

                        以上就是关于如何创建加密货币的全面指南,希望对你有所帮助。在科技快速发展的今天,拥抱数字货币的潮流,将可能为你开启新的投资机遇和商业模式。无论你是想探索新的科技领域,还是希望通过加密货币获得收益,这篇文章提供的步骤和见解都将是一个良好的起点。

                                  author

                                  Appnox App

                                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                related post

                                                
                                                        

                                                  leave a reply